A new type of ketolides, bearing an N-aryl-alkyl acetamide moiety at the C-9 iminoether and a cyclic carbonate at the C-11,12 position was prepared and the antibacterial activities of the compounds were evaluated. Some of the derivatives showed potent antibacterial activity against both Haemophilus influenzae and Streptococcus pneumoniae, which are clinically important respiratory tract pathogens. Among the derivatives prepared, compound 5s with a quinolin-4-yl moiety was found to have potent and well-balanced activity against S. pneumoniae and H. influenzae including erythromycin-resistant strains.

A new type of ketolide bearing an N-aryl-alkyl acetamide moiety at the C-9 iminoether and its analogues were prepared, and their antibacterial activities and pharmacokinetic properties were evaluated. We found that the introduction of an (R)-alkyl group between the amide and iminoether groups could improve the pharmacokinetic properties while maintaining the activity against erythromycin-resistant Streptococcus pneumoniae. Among the ketolides prepared with the (R)-alkyl group, compound 5p with an N-(3-quinoxalin-6-yl-propyl)-propionamide moiety was found to have in vivo efficacy comparable to CAM with potent in vitro antibacterial activities against the key respiratory pathogens including Haemophilus influenzae and erythromycin-resistant S. pneumoniae.
